General annotation (Comments)

Catalytic activity

(S)-lactate + NAD+ = pyruvate + NADH. HAMAP MF_00488

Pathway

Fermentation; pyruvate fermentation to lactate; (S)-lactate from pyruvate: step 1/1. HAMAP MF_00488

Subunit structure

Homotetramer By similarity. HAMAP MF_00488

Subcellular location

Cytoplasm By similarity HAMAP MF_00488.

Sequence similarities

Belongs to the LDH/MDH superfamily. LDH family.
